Zelenskyy Meets U.S. Senators, Pushes for Stronger Security Guarantees and Military Aid
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y in meeting with U.S. senators on February 28, 2025, in Washington, D.C.

President Volodymyr Zelenskyy met with a bipartisan delegation from the U.S. Senate in Washington during his visit to the United States.

Discussions focused on continued military assistance to Ukraine, legislative initiatives related to aid, a meeting with former President Donald Trump, efforts to achieve a just and lasting peace, Ukraine’s vision for ending the war, and the need for reliable security guarantees.

"We are proud to have such strategic partners and friends as the United States of America," Zelenskyy said, thanking U.S. lawmakers for their "unwavering bicameral and bipartisan support" throughout three years of full-scale Russian aggression.

Earlier, U.S. President Donald Trump and British Prime Minister Keir Starmer met at the White House on February 27 for their first in-person talks since Trump’s election.
